Richard, I think that UShip is similar to Shiply that Paul mentions. I used to UShip to contract shipping for a parts car from Oregon to Utah for $600. It wasn't in an enclosed trailer but you can specify anything you want. UShip lets customers and transporters work out the price amongst themselves. You can usually get a pretty good deal because a driver would rather take your car back East for a reduced fee than go back home empty. Kelly |
